    • Sorry it's long and tissues might be needed...My puppy/dog got Parvo wen he was 8 months old. He was in better than perfect health when he came down with it. I didn't have the money to take him to the vet until a Friday (he started acting sick on a Monday). By then he was skin and bones (went from a healthy 125 to about 75 pounds in 4 days) and couldn't move at all! I took him to the vets and told them to do a test for Parvo. I was almost positive that's what he had. When the doctor came back in and told me that's what he had, I started crying immediately. I told the vet I didn't have much money (I basically brought the money I had put aside for rent that month). When they gave me the estimate for just the days worth of hospitalization (almost $9,000 for one day) I told them to put him down. There was no way I could come up with that kind of money in a day! The vet left and I fell onto the floor to hold my dog for one last moment. When the vet came back in, I was expecting to see the syringe with "the pink stuff" but she didn't have that. She came back with 2 more vet techs and two huge bags of IV solution. And a handful of shots. They started giving my dog all these things and I started crying more. I kept telling them to stop, I couldn't afford it! Please just put him down and make him stop hurting! She pulled me aside and told me the hospital would pick up the bill! She sent me home that day with a huge bag of pills to give him and my dog that was more like a wet wash cloth than a dog with how weak he was. And some great advice... she said he hasn't given up yet and neither should you! I slept with my dog on the kitchen floor for four weeks until he was finally able to lift his head by himself again. I hand fed him every couple hours. I bathed him every time he defecated. There was nothing that would stop me from making sure he would get better! And he did!It took almost 2 months for him to get back to about 90% of what he was before this happened to him. I fed him white rice and plain chicken. When he was able to keep that down, I started him on white rice and ground beef. And we kept moving up from there. My dog in now 3 years young! And works as a police dog for our local police station!Good luck to you and your dog!! My wishes are with you!!!
